Univ. of Phoenix Offering Credits for Industry Professionals
Insurance professionals who have passed exams administered by the American Institute for CPCU and the Insurance Institute of America (AICPCU/IIA) can now gain credit for those exams in the University of Phoenix’s undergraduate business and management degree programs.
Students must provide an official training record, a certificate specifying the number of classroom hours and date of course completion, or other verification of course completion such as an official transcript from AICPCU/IIA. The University will award credit for a posting fee of $25 per credit.
Students who wish to receive such credit must complete the University’s Non-Degree submission form for Professional Training and Coursework Credit, and attach a copy of the verification of completion and send the form to the Prior Learning Assessment Center for evaluation. A maximum of 60 to 69 lower division credits are eligible for transfer into the business and management undergraduate degree programs, based on the requirements of each program.
